According to 6Wresearch internal database and industry insights, the Global Wireless Medical Device Connectivity Market was valued at USD 3.2 Billion in 2024 and is expected to reach USD 8.2 Billion by 2031, growing at a compound annual growth rate of 11.30% during the forecast period (2025-2031).
The Global Wireless Medical Device Connectivity Market is experiencing significant growth driven by the need for improved healthcare efficiency and the growing adoption of telemedicine. This market encompasses wireless technologies that enable the seamless integration and communication of medical devices with healthcare systems, allowing for real-time monitoring, data collection, and analysis. Key factors driving market growth include the increasing prevalence of chronic diseases, the demand for remote patient monitoring solutions, and the implementation of electronic health records. The market is characterized by the presence of major players offering a wide range of connectivity solutions, such as Bluetooth, Wi-Fi, and Zigbee, to enhance healthcare delivery and patient outcomes. However, challenges related to data security and interoperability issues may hinder market growth in the coming years.

The Global Wireless Medical Device Connectivity Market is influenced by various government policies aimed at regulating the use of wireless technology in healthcare settings. These policies focus on ensuring data security, patient privacy, and interoperability of medical devices to improve healthcare delivery. Governments worldwide are implementing regulations such as the Health Insurance Portability and Accountability Act (HIPAA) in the United States and the General Data Protection Regulation (GDPR) in Europe to safeguard patient information exchanged through wireless medical devices. Additionally, initiatives like the FDA`s Digital Health Innovation Action Plan support the development and integration of wireless medical devices while ensuring their safety and effectiveness. Overall, government policies play a crucial role in shaping the landscape of the Global Wireless Medical Device Connectivity Market by promoting innovation, patient safety, and data protection.
